LAKSHADWEEP COPS FILE SEDITION CASE AGAINST FILMMAKER
The Lakshadweep Police have registered a case of sedition against filmmaker Aisha Sultana for allegedly calling the Union territory’s administrator Praful Khoda Patel a “bio-weapon” launched by the Centre.
Sultana, a Lakshadweep resident, made the comment during a TV discussion amid anger in the region over new rules introduced by Patel, which his opponents say threaten the livelihoods of islanders.
The case against her was lodged in Kavaratti on the complaint of Lakshadweep Bharatiya Janata Party chief C Abdul Khadar Haji on Thursday. In his complaint, Haji cited a debate where Sultana purportedly calling Patel a “bio-weapon”.
